INTERLINING (plural INTERLININGs) A cloth lining between the outer and inner layers of a garment. Correction or alteration by writing between the lines; interlineation. The scheduling of vehicles to operate more than one route, or the selling of tickets for a trip across multiple carriersSynonyms
